Garage doors naturally make some noise when they run, however sudden or uncommonly loud sounds should not be ignored. If your door has actually ended up being significantly louder than regular, there may be a problem with one or more of its moving parts.
Grinding, screeching, popping, banging, rattling and persistent squeaking can all suggest prospective issues. Grinding may be associated with worn rollers or issues with the tracks, while a loud popping sound can sometimes indicate a concern with a garage door spring.
In some cases, a squeaky garage door might simply need proper lubrication. However, if lubrication does not solve the sound or the noise keeps returning, there may be underlying wear that requires professional attention.
It is necessary not to dismantle or change springs and cable televisions yourself. These parts can be under substantial tension and inaccurate handling can cause severe injury.
A professional garage door technician can check the moving parts and recognize the source of the noise. Attending to the concern early may likewise assist prevent damage to other elements.
A properly operating garage door ought to move smoothly and remain fairly level as it travels along its tracks. If one side of the door rises faster than the other or the door appears misaligned throughout operation, there might be an issue with the balance or alignment of the system.
You might discover that one side sits higher than the other when the door is open. The bottom of the door may likewise stop working to satisfy the ground evenly when it closes. In many cases, the door may shake, drag or appear to move at an angle.
A number of components might contribute to this issue, consisting of springs, cables, rollers or tracks. Continuing to run an irregular door can put extra stress on the automated opener and other mechanical elements.
A professional technician can check the whole system rather than just adjusting the most apparent part. This is essential due to the fact that garage doors count on numerous interconnected parts to operate properly.
If your garage door no longer moves evenly, arranging an assessment can help recognize the issue before the door ends up being completely stuck.
Another common indication is a garage door that has actually become visibly slower than it utilized to be. If your door takes substantially longer to open or close, hesitates before moving or appears to struggle throughout operation, it ought to be checked.
A sluggish garage door can have several possible causes. The tracks may require attention, the rollers may be worn, the springs may be losing their effectiveness or the automatic opener may be experiencing a problem.
Focus on changes in how the door sounds and moves. If the motor appears to be working more difficult than typical or the door stops and starts during operation, continuing to use it without recognizing the cause could result in additional wear.
Your garage door opener is developed to run a properly balanced door. When the door becomes much heavier or more difficult to move, the opener may require to work more difficult to raise it.
Gradually, this extra stress can contribute to premature wear of the opener and other parts.
A professional inspection can determine whether the issue is related to the opener itself or another part of the garage door system.
If your garage door starts closing after you have actually completely opened it, this is a major warning indication. A correctly functioning door should be able to stay open without unexpectedly dropping or slowly moving towards the ground.
The garage door spring system plays a crucial function in counterbalancing the weight of the door. When springs end up being used or damaged, the door can become much heavier and more hard to control.
You may discover that the door feels uncommonly heavy when run by hand or that it begins to drop after reaching the open position.
A malfunctioning spring can likewise position extra stress on the garage door opener. In some scenarios, continued usage can result in additional damage to the door or opener.
Garage door springs must not be fixed or replaced as a DIY task. They can store a considerable quantity of energy, and incorrect handling can cause severe injuries.
If your door can not remain open safely, stop using it where possible and call a professional garage door professional for an inspection.
A garage door that consistently gets stuck is another clear sign that something is wrong. The door may stop halfway, decline to open completely or become stuck at a particular point during its motion.
In other cases, the door may act inconsistently and stop at different positions.
Potential causes can consist of damaged tracks, worn rollers, cable television problems, spring issues, obstructions or faults with the automatic opener. For automated garage doors, problems with the safety sensing units can also impact the door's capability to close.
Before arranging a repair work, you can examine whether there is an obvious item obstructing the door's path. You can also ensure the area around the security sensing units is clear.
If there is no obvious blockage and the issue continues, expert evaluation is suggested.
Repeatedly requiring a garage door to open or close can put additional pressure on its components. What begins as a relatively little fault can become more complicated if the door continues running under abnormal conditions.
Some garage door issues can be determined through an easy visual evaluation. You might discover a damaged cable television, bent track, broken roller, rusted part, loose bracket or harmed door panel.
Noticeable damage ought to not be ignored, especially if it impacts an element responsible for supporting or managing the motion of the door.
For instance, a torn cable television can become more damaged over time and might ultimately break. A bent track can affect how smoothly the rollers move, while harmed rollers can increase friction and noise.
Perth's climate can also add to degeneration. Strong UV exposure can impact certain materials and finishes, while wetness and salty air may add to deterioration, particularly for homes located closer to the coast.
If you notice an element that looks harmed, avoid attempting to align, eliminate or repair it yourself. An expert technician can figure out whether the element can be fixed or requires to be replaced.
Determining visible wear early can help prevent a more significant failure later on.
Modern automated garage doors include security features developed to lower the threat of accidents. If your door all of a sudden reverses, refuses to close properly or behaves in a different way from normal, it ought to be examined.
For instance, the door may begin closing and then right away reverse. It might stop before reaching the ground, run periodically or fail to respond consistently to the remote.
Safety sensing units can in some cases be responsible for unusual behaviour. If sensors end up being dirty, misaligned or obstructed, the door might identify an evident blockage and reverse.
However, unpredictable operation can also be triggered by issues with the opener, circuitry, remote controls or mechanical parts.
Do not bypass or disable safety features just to make the door operate. These systems are developed to secure individuals, pets and residential or commercial property.
If your garage door is acting unexpectedly, an expert can test the opener, sensing units and mechanical elements to identify the underlying cause.
When Should You Call a Garage Door Expert?
Knowing when to arrange a repair can assist prevent a small concern from ending up being a major failure.
If your garage door has suddenly become loud, slow, irregular or difficult to operate, it is worth having it examined. The exact same applies if you discover visible damage, a damaged spring, a damaged cable television or a door that consistently gets stuck.
Issues including springs, cables, tracks and other mechanical elements ought to typically be managed by a trained specialist. These parts can support substantial weight and, in some cases, remain under substantial stress even when the door is not moving.
Professional repair work can also assist determine the root cause of the problem rather than simply attending to the sign.
For instance, replacing a used roller may resolve extreme sound, but if the roller has been using prematurely since the track is misaligned, the underlying issue likewise requires to be dealt with.

How Routine Garage Door Maintenance Can Help
You do not need to wait till your garage door quits working before organizing an assessment.
Regular upkeep can help recognize worn components before they fail. An expert can evaluate the condition of the springs, cables, rollers, tracks, hinges, brackets, safety sensors and automated opener.
Regular attention can likewise help keep smooth operation and possibly extend the working life of your garage door components.
Property owners can also focus on changes in the door's behaviour. If it begins making a brand-new noise, moving more slowly or needing more effort to run, these modifications must not be dismissed.
Early intervention can often avoid a reasonably uncomplicated repair work from developing into a larger and more expensive issue.
